Common Signs Your Water Heater Needs a Tune-Up
Is your water heater trying to tell you something? Be alert for these common warning signs that indicate it’s time to schedule a professional maintenance visit:
- Inconsistent Water Temperature: If your water fluctuates between hot and cold or is consistently lukewarm, it could be due to sediment buildup on the heating elements or a faulty thermostat.
- Strange Noises: Popping, rumbling, or crackling sounds from the tank are often caused by a layer of mineral sediment at the bottom. As the water is heated, steam bubbles get trapped beneath the sediment, causing the noise.
- Discolored or Smelly Water: Water that appears rusty or has a metallic odor points to corrosion inside the tank or a deteriorating anode rod. This is a critical issue that requires immediate attention.
- Visible Leaks or Moisture: Any amount of water pooling around the base of your water heater is a serious concern. Leaks can originate from fittings, the T&P valve, or the tank itself, indicating a potential for significant water damage.
- Rising Energy Bills: An inefficient water heater has to work harder and run longer to heat the same amount of water, leading to a noticeable increase in your utility costs.
- Slow Hot Water Recovery: If it seems to take longer and longer for your tank to refill with hot water after use, the system is likely struggling with inefficiency or a failing component.

Our Comprehensive Water Heater Maintenance Checklist
When an Evergreen Heating and Air LLC technician services your system, we perform a detailed inspection and tune-up designed to restore efficiency and prevent future breakdowns. Our maintenance process addresses every critical component of your water heater.
- Tank Flushing and Sediment Removal: Over time, minerals like calcium and magnesium settle at the bottom of your tank, forming a hard layer of sediment. This buildup insulates the water from the heating element or burner, forcing the system to work harder. We completely flush the tank to remove this sediment, improving energy transfer and extending the tank's life.
- Anode Rod Inspection and Replacement: The anode rod is a "sacrificial" component made of magnesium or aluminum that is designed to corrode instead of your tank's inner lining. We inspect this rod and recommend replacement if it's significantly deteriorated, protecting your tank from rust and premature failure.
- Temperature & Pressure (T&P) Valve Test: This vital safety feature is designed to release pressure if it builds to dangerous levels inside the tank. We test the T&P valve to ensure it opens and closes correctly, protecting your home and family from a potential tank rupture.
- Burner or Heating Element Inspection: For gas models, we clean and inspect the burner assembly for proper ignition and flame. For electric models, we check the heating elements for signs of damage or sediment buildup that could cause them to fail.
- Thermostat and Controls Check: We verify that your thermostat is reading the temperature accurately and calibrate it for optimal performance and energy savings. This ensures your water is heated to a safe and comfortable temperature without wasting energy.
- Leak and Corrosion Inspection: Our technicians conduct a thorough visual inspection of the entire unit, including pipes, fittings, and the tank itself, to identify any signs of leaks or external corrosion that could lead to future problems.
The Value of Professional Maintenance
Investing in annual maintenance is far more cost-effective than dealing with the consequences of neglect. Regular service ensures your system operates at peak efficiency, keeping your energy bills low. By identifying and addressing minor issues like a worn-out anode rod or a faulty valve, we can help you avoid catastrophic failures and postpone the need for a full Water Heater Replacement.
